Output 68255e906c677049507d9b02b69302e02f57105ef6128e1e60a88b0a9f76b0f4:6

value
50378596
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 562901b9cd8789a8887665766fc9c42d3fba6c1b OP_EQUALVERIFY OP_CHECKSIG
address
18raEhMXVF4g1wM64vue3GCUDrAdadJWem
transaction
68255e906c677049507d9b02b69302e02f57105ef6128e1e60a88b0a9f76b0f4
confirmations
510485
spent
true